Video: Cory Roper Sent Driver’s Side-First Into Frontstretch Wall After Contact From Tyler Hill

Even though Cory Roper was walking away gingerly after a hard crash into the frontstretch wall with under 20 laps to go in Friday’s NASCAR Camping World Truck Series Bucked Up 200 at Las Vegas Motor Speedway, it was just nice to see him be able to walk away.

Tyler Hill was sent spinning to the inside of the track, where Roper was running. Roper had nowhere to go as Hill’s No. 56 Camping World machine clipped the rear of Roper, sending his No. 04 truck hard into the wall, driver’s side first.

Both drivers are done for the night. For Hill, this ends his 16-race streak with no DNF to start his NASCAR Camping World Truck Series career.
